Output dd55aa58b81ce5e0631fd9ee8174267e9583535ad3e7b14ee635db8f6423ea47:1

value
99357736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d414310e40bb7e91c5cdf52ef459c619378a6723 OP_EQUAL
address
3M2PN9gFPXbq2P2ebiWrm4ynbRPv2JQEKd
transaction
dd55aa58b81ce5e0631fd9ee8174267e9583535ad3e7b14ee635db8f6423ea47
spent
true